Psalm 16:9

Definition: Therefore my heart is glad, and my glory rejoiceth: my flesh also shall rest in hope.


Explanation: Okay, let’s break down Psalm 16:9 – “Therefore my heart is glad, and my glory rejoiceth: my flesh also shall rest in hope.” It's a really beautiful and comforting verse from the Bible. Here’s what it means in simpler terms: Basically, it’s saying: God loves me so much that my joy and happiness are overflowing, and He’s making things comfortable for me – even to the point of peace and rest. Let's unpack it a little more: “My heart is glad” : This means you feel happy and pleased with God’s presence in your life. It’s a feeling of contentment and gratitude. “My glory rejoiceth” : “Glory” refers to God’s wonderful character, His power, and His perfection. "Rejoiceth" is a strong word – it means to rejoice, to be filled with joy, and to be pleased. It's like saying "I am delighted!" “My flesh also shall rest in hope” : This is the really important part. “Flesh” refers to your body - you are vulnerable and can get hurt. But “rest” means to find peace and security. It’s suggesting that God doesn't just want you, He gives you a sense of security and comfort – a feeling that everything is going to be okay, even when things are difficult. It’s like knowing that even though life can have challenges, God is in control and will protect you. So, the whole verse paints a picture of: God's love is so great that it brings about a deep and joyful feeling within you , and He provides a sense of peace and security, allowing you to trust in His care and protection.
